Development of modified micro-pulling-down method for bromide and chloride single crystals

摘要

We developed a modified micro-pulling-down (mu-PD) method for the crystal growth of halide materials with highly hygroscopic nature. A removable chamber system of the modified mu-PD method that can enter a globe box filled with Ar gas enabled to handle starting materials, set up a crucible and hot zone, grow a single crystal from the melt and take out a grown crystal without exposing to outside atmosphere. By the modified mu-PD method, CeCl(3) and Ce 1% doped LaBr(3) single crystals, which were famous as scintillator with high light yield and energy resolution were grown. Grown CeCl(3) and Ce:LaBr3 single crystals indicated high transparency and they have no visible cracks and inclusions. In photoluminescence measurements, emission peak around 365 nm was observed for CeCl(3) single crystal and Ce:LaBr3 single crystal indicated two emission peaks around 360 and 380 nm, which originated from 5d-4f transition of Ce(3+) ion.
